food bank usage

Food bank usage by Canadians have gone up tremendously in the last few years. Just from 2008 to 2014 food bank usage

has gone up 247%. Food bank usage has increased more than double from 2008. People who use food banks aren't usually homeless. Most people who use the food banks are people with jobs but can't afford to buy food. They have to use their hard earned money to pay other bills and by the time they've paid they wouldn't have enough money to buy food for themselves or their family.
